The History of BB Creams
Beauty or Blemish Cream (BB Cream) is not new and has been around for over fifty years. It was first developed by a German dermatologist Dr.Christine Schrammek in the 1950s for her own patients to sooth skin, reduce redness and give it a more natural look after treatments such as peels.
Dr. Schrammek’s site still sells the original BB cream.
BB cream was then introduced to Asia where it was popular in countries such as Korea and Japan.
